As far as Type 4 is concerned, there's absolutely no way that Disrupting Shoal will be disappointing. Discarding a blue card is an alternate casting cost. You can still hardcast the thing -- and in Type 4, that's trivial. Just as with Spell Blast, Disrupting Shoal would be just another hard counter in T4.

Hmm, these are all maybes for my stack (I have lots of random critters and a low power level)

Ashen Monstrosity (7/4, must attack each turn)
Final Judgement (RFG Wrath)
Fumiko the Low Blood (All oppo's creatures attack each turn, Bushido = no of attackers)
Genju of the Realm (5 colour one... prob. not enough lands, but it would be funny)
Heed the Mists (cmc based card draw)
Ink Eyes (Rat ninja reanimate guy)
Jetting Glasskite (4/4 flyer, counter first spell targeting it each turn)
Mannichi, the Fevered Dream (About Face activated ability)
Opal-Eye, Konda's Yojimbo (Infinite toughness)
Ornate Kanzashi (Artifact, T:steal opponent's top card)
Shining Shoal (Redirect X damage)
Siverstorm Samurai (Instant speed creature)
Stir the Grave (Reanimation)
Sway the Stars (Reset game, life totals start at 7)
That Which Was Taken (Makes things IN...DES...TRUCTABLE... CAPTAIN SCARLET!!!! De doom doom de doo doo doom)... That's a great program Very Happy
Toshro Umezawa (Yawg Will an instant whenever oppo's creature dies)
Twist Allegiance (You and target oppo swap creatures until eot)

I'm not too impressed with the set overall. The bulk of the playable cards are just variations of removal. I really like interesting, never seen before kind of stuff. The cards that jump out in that department are Ornate Kaza-whatever and That Which Was Taken, but they both seem like mid-range picks.

I'm not sure about Sway of the Stars; it looks really cool but is symmetrical and Draw7s in general have not proven themselves in our stack. The card that I like the best I think is the White Shoal, though the fact that it's only one source is very "Meh." Ink-Eyes is mad cool, what with it being a Ninja and not being the spell for turn, and I'm sure it'll win some games, but it's cards like that that never seem to work when you want them to. (We also don't have many 187's, which make him infintely better)

I haven't taken an in depth look at the Spoiler though, so there might be some gems I missed, but otherwise I give this set about a 4 out of 10.

EDIT: I think this set would be a lot better if there were enough Arcane cards to make Splice reliable, rather than a freak occurence. The only one we're playing with right now is Reweave. Also, Spiritcraft is useless now, but this set has some back-breaking Spiritcraft stuff if there were only enough.
